I think an explicit part of the remit of the BBC is some form of non-commercial public service. They are actually meant to broadcast unpopular stuff. 6 Music and Radio 3 seem like obvious examples of this - among many others.
Here they could be seen to be trying to break a vicious circle of underexposure.
Women's football is not on the telly.
Therefore fewer girls play it.
Therefore the standard is low.
Therefore women's football is not on the telly.
I'm glad they are.
